#880007 - RGB(136, 0, 7) - Red Berry Color FAQ

What is the color code for Red Berry?

Hex color code for Red Berry color is #880007. RGB color code for red berry color is rgb(136, 0, 7).

What is the RGB value of #880007?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#880007 is rgb(136, 0, 7).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'136' indicates the intensity of the red component, '0' represents the green component's intensity, and '7'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#880007.

What is the RGB percentage of #880007?

The RGB percentage composition for the hexadecimal color code #880007 is detailed as follows: 53.3% Red, 0% Green, and 2.7% Blue. This breakdown indicates the relative contribution of each primary color in the RGB color model to achieve this specific shade. The value 53.3% for Red signifies a dominant red component, contributing significantly to the overall color. The Green and Blue components are comparatively lower, with 0% and 2.7% respectively, playing a smaller role in the composition of this particular hue. Together, these percentages of Red, Green, and Blue mix to form the distinct color represented by #880007.

What does RGB 136,0,7 mean?

The RGB color 136, 0, 7 represents a dull and muted shade of Red. The websafe version of this color is hex 990000.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Red Berry.
